Lemon Blueberry Loaf

Ingredients
  

1 ½ cups all-purpose flour

1 teaspoon baking powder

½ teaspoon baking soda

¼ teaspoon salt

½ cup unsalted butter, softened

1 cup granulated sugar

2 large eggs

2 teaspoons vanilla extract

1 tablespoon lemon zest (about 1 lemon)

2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ice

½ cup buttermilk

1 ½ cups fresh blueberries (or frozen, if fresh isn’t available)

2 tablespoons all-purpose flour (for tossing with blueberries)

For the Lemon Glaze:

1 cup powdered sugar

2 tablespoons lemon juice

1 tablespoon lemon zest

Instructions
 

Preheat Oven: Begin by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9x5 inch loaf pan or line it with parchment paper for easy removal.

    Mix Dry Ingredients: In a medium bowl, whisk together 1 ½ cups fl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Set aside.

      Cream Butter and Sugar: In a large mixing bowl, using an electric mixer, cream together the softened butter and granulated sugar until light and fluffy (about 3-4 minutes).

        Add Eggs & Flavor: Beat in the eggs, one at a time, ensuring each is fully incorporated. Then add the vanilla extract, lemon zest, and lemon juice, mixing until smooth.

          Combine Wet and Dry Ingredients: Gradually add the dry mixture to the wet mixture, alternating with the buttermilk. Start and end with the dry ingredients, mixing until just combined (do not over-mix).

            Prepare Blueberries: In a small bowl, toss the fresh blueberries with the remaining 2 tablespoons of flour. This helps prevent them from sinking in the batter.

              Fold in Blueberries: Gently fold the blueberries into the batter with a spatula, being careful not to break them.

                Pour & Bake: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an, smoothing the top with a spatula. Bake for 55-65 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

                  Cool Loaf: Once baked, allow the loaf to cool in the pan for about 10 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ely.

                    Make Lemon Glaze: While the loaf is cooling, prepare the glaze by whisking together powdered sugar, lemon juice, and lemon zest in a small bowl until smooth.

                      Glaze the Loaf: Once the loaf is cool, drizzle the lemon glaze over the top, letting it drip down the sides for a beautiful finish.

                        Serve & Enjoy: Slice the loaf and serve either warm or at room temperature. This zesty treat pairs wonderfully with a cup of tea or coffee!

                          Prep Time: 15 minutes | Total Time: 1 hour 20 minutes | Servings: 8-10
